版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進(jìn)行舉報或認(rèn)領(lǐng)
文檔簡介
1、 在直連存儲系統(tǒng)的時代,應(yīng)用系統(tǒng)以計算機(jī)為中心,存儲只是外設(shè),數(shù)據(jù)是存儲孤島 在存儲網(wǎng)絡(luò)時代,數(shù)據(jù)成為信息系統(tǒng)的核心,應(yīng)用系統(tǒng)充分挖掘數(shù)據(jù)的價值,服務(wù)器成為存儲系統(tǒng)的外設(shè)應(yīng)用系統(tǒng)操作系統(tǒng)文件系統(tǒng)RAID控制磁盤讀寫文件級傳輸文件級傳輸塊級傳輸塊級傳輸文件級傳輸:應(yīng)用系統(tǒng)的I/O邏輯請求,它是文件系統(tǒng)的輸入。是應(yīng)用系統(tǒng)要求存儲做什么的邏輯請求。文件系統(tǒng)決定數(shù)據(jù)(包括META數(shù)據(jù))在磁盤上的存放格式和位置,這種格式和位置又決定磁頭的移動方式。塊級傳輸:應(yīng)用系統(tǒng)的I/O物理請求,它是文件系統(tǒng)的輸出。是怎么對存儲操作的數(shù)據(jù)塊請求。 RAID控制使文件系統(tǒng)看到一個大邏輯盤。 它不管磁盤格式。文件系統(tǒng)對存
2、儲系統(tǒng)的效率有舉足輕重的作用應(yīng)用系統(tǒng)操作系統(tǒng)文件系統(tǒng)RAID控制磁盤讀寫NASFC SAN應(yīng)用服務(wù)器應(yīng)用服務(wù)器以太網(wǎng)交換機(jī)以太網(wǎng)交換機(jī)NAS FC 交換機(jī)交換機(jī)SAN應(yīng)用服務(wù)器應(yīng)用服務(wù)器文件系統(tǒng)文件系統(tǒng)RAIDRAID文件系統(tǒng)文件系統(tǒng)RAID文件系統(tǒng)文件系統(tǒng)RAID應(yīng)用服務(wù)器應(yīng)用服務(wù)器文件系統(tǒng)文件系統(tǒng)應(yīng)用服務(wù)器應(yīng)用服務(wù)器人們經(jīng)常高估帶寬的作用。他們一看到網(wǎng)絡(luò)變慢,就想到是帶寬不夠了,其實(shí)往往是其他原因。我個人還從來沒有看到因?yàn)閹挷粔蛐枰獜?-Gbps生到4-Gbps的情況。Quite often people are not exceeding their bandwidths. They
3、see a network slowdown and think they are exceeding their pipeline, but often it is something else. Im not yet personally seeing anyplace where the need to exceed 2-Gbps is a reason to push for 4-Gbps. 隨著4-Gbps產(chǎn)品價格下落,對大映像文件存取所用的SAN會是最好的選擇。但對于象數(shù)據(jù)庫這樣的應(yīng)用所用的SAN來說,增添的性能是多余的。With the price of 4-Gbps produ
4、cts expected to fall, it will be the best alternative for installing new SANs, or for existing SANs where large imaging or R&D files are stored and accessed. But for existing SANs used for such applications as databases, the extra performance may not be necessary. - 摘自“IBM Latest Vendor To Throw
5、 Hat Into 4Gbps Ring” CRN 5-9-05什麼是文件系統(tǒng)?計算機(jī)的文件系統(tǒng)是任何信息管理系統(tǒng)的基本元素。它是處理過的信息最終被放置的地方。關(guān)鍵應(yīng)用系統(tǒng)的客戶依靠文件系統(tǒng)得到快速、不間斷的可靠的數(shù)據(jù)訪問 。 VERITAS指數(shù)據(jù)(包括文件和metadata)在存儲介質(zhì)上的組織管理模式,以便能快速可靠地存取數(shù)據(jù)。文件系統(tǒng)是最初的存儲“虛擬者”。每個操作系統(tǒng)都有自己的文件系統(tǒng)。例如操作系統(tǒng)所支持的文件系統(tǒng)MS-DOS, Windows 95 FAT16Windows 95,98,MeFAT16,FAT32Windows NT,2000,XPNTFS,FAT16,FAT32Lin
6、uxExt2,FAT32,FAT16不同的文件系統(tǒng)有不同的格式。例如文件系統(tǒng)最長文件名 最大卷大小 最大文件大小FAT1682GB*2GBFAT322552TB4GBNTFS25516TB16TBExt22554TB2GBWAFL Writes to nearest available free blockBerkeley Fast File System/Veritas Fast File System/NTFS Writes to pre-allocated locations (data and metadata).文件系統(tǒng)決定了磁頭如何讀寫磁盤磁頭是毫秒級操作,最大限度地減少磁頭臂的平
7、均移動次數(shù),是提高讀寫效率的關(guān)鍵對誰有用? 大郵件目錄 新聞大目錄環(huán)境每秒創(chuàng)建數(shù)Directory SizeSunOSNetApp 2.0NetApp 2.110003011312250002268123100001640122200001214122數(shù)據(jù)卷Snapshot卷需要建立快照卷Data VolumeSnapshot Volume必須進(jìn)行數(shù)據(jù)拷貝Data VolumeSnapshot VolumeABCActive File SystemFile: NETAPP.DATDisk blocksSnapshot.0File: NETAPP.DATABCActive File System
8、File: NETAPP.DATDisk blocksSnapshot 僅僅記錄這三個僅僅記錄這三個數(shù)據(jù)塊的指針數(shù)據(jù)塊的指針, 沒有數(shù)據(jù)拷貝沒有數(shù)據(jù)拷貝Snapshot.0File: NETAPP.DATCWAFL把修改后的數(shù)據(jù)塊寫到新位置 (C)現(xiàn)在數(shù)據(jù)塊 (C) 既沒有被更新,也沒有被釋放ABCActive File SystemFile: NETAPP.DATDisk blocks顧客修改數(shù)據(jù)塊 C新數(shù)據(jù)新數(shù)據(jù)當(dāng)前文件系統(tǒng) NETAPP.DAT 現(xiàn)在由數(shù)據(jù)塊 A, B 和 C組成.NETAPP.DAT 的Snapshot.0由數(shù)據(jù)塊 A, B 和 C 組成. 可以同時保留多個文件系統(tǒng)版本
9、, 用于系統(tǒng)快速恢復(fù)CSnapshot.0File: NETAPP.DATABCActive File SystemFile: NETAPP.DATDisk blocks把模塊把模塊“C”改為改為“Z”其它File Systems (例如, NTFS, UFS)存在存在 Snapshot每個 write I/O 變?yōu)?Read old valueWrite old valueWrite new value300% I/O penalty把模塊把模塊“C” 改為改為“Z”Write Anywhere File Layout 一個 write I/O 保持為一個 I/O當(dāng)前文件當(dāng)前文件系統(tǒng)系統(tǒng)Sn
10、apshot當(dāng)前文件當(dāng)前文件系統(tǒng)系統(tǒng)Snapshot當(dāng)前文件當(dāng)前文件系統(tǒng)系統(tǒng)SnapshotCABCDABZDZABCDv磁盤寫操作涉及磁頭臂的機(jī)械運(yùn)動,可以用帶電池的緩存來減短應(yīng)用的中斷時間v緩存可以把單個寫操作,積累成批量寫操作,從而提高磁盤陣列的寫效率v寫緩存可以放在文件系統(tǒng)級或卷管理級進(jìn)程中斷時間最短, 客戶響應(yīng)時間加快, 可預(yù)見NVRAM: 保證快速寫操作保證快速寫操作保證所寫數(shù)據(jù)與磁盤的一致性, 縮短中斷時間UNIX NVRAMNetApp NVRAMDisk DriverNVRAMSemantic LayerWrite alloc Layer File System NFS Di
11、sk DriverNVRAMSemantic LayerWrite alloc LayerFile System NFS NAS gateway方法 缺點(diǎn):兩個管理界面效率不匹配(NAS gateway可能是瓶頸)資源不能完全共享硬件資源浪費(fèi)(Cache)適用情況:絕大部分?jǐn)?shù)據(jù)是結(jié)構(gòu)化的,少量是非結(jié)構(gòu)化的CFS:在群集范圍內(nèi)的所有存儲設(shè)備上的每個存儲塊可以被并發(fā)讀寫。它不適用顧客,只適用服務(wù)器。 CFS通過分布鎖管理器(DLM)來實(shí)現(xiàn)數(shù)據(jù)共享。如:ADIC的StorNext,IBM的DFS:它協(xié)調(diào)所有的服務(wù)器實(shí)現(xiàn)數(shù)據(jù)共享。它對顧客和服務(wù)器采用2層結(jié)構(gòu)的文件系統(tǒng)。在顧客層,它實(shí)現(xiàn)跨越所有機(jī)器的統(tǒng)
12、一命名空間和單個文件系統(tǒng)的表達(dá)方式。它的服務(wù)器層承擔(dān)所有的I/O操作,從數(shù)據(jù)存儲的觀點(diǎn)看,服務(wù)器層相當(dāng)于存儲層,有時就簡稱為存儲結(jié)點(diǎn)。在DFS結(jié)構(gòu)中,每個物理服務(wù)器管理自己的存儲資源,不同的物理服務(wù)器彼此并不直接共享存儲資源。如:NetApp的SpinFS(現(xiàn)在的Data ONTAP NG )群集服務(wù)器客戶端FC交換機(jī)Metadata控制器SAN卷 每個群集服務(wù)器看到的是相同的SAN卷 用控制器統(tǒng)一管理群集服務(wù)器對SAN卷中文件的共享 可以支持從主機(jī)到存儲的多路徑合并 可以支持異構(gòu)平臺的互操作GX 1GX 1GX 2GX 2GX 3GX 3GX 4GX 4FCFC通路靈活卷GigE GigE
13、顧客網(wǎng)絡(luò)LinuxLinux計算網(wǎng)格GXGXClusterClusterGigE GigE 群集網(wǎng)絡(luò)(可以構(gòu)架為冗余)10/100/1000 10/100/1000 管理網(wǎng)絡(luò)FCFC失效恢復(fù)路徑匯聚FCFC 或 ATA ATA 磁盤架InfiniBand InfiniBand 系統(tǒng)失效恢復(fù)連接簡單 所有參加計算的節(jié)點(diǎn),可以看到所有數(shù)據(jù) 簡化mount點(diǎn)的管理 在顧客端無需改動透明 擴(kuò)展 靈活卷的移動 失效接管擴(kuò)展性 將命名空間用于PB數(shù)量級數(shù)據(jù) 可管理性Proj_ABCProj_ABCEngEngSynSynSimSimDocsDocsSWSWHWHWProj_XYZProj_XYZGX 1G
14、X 1GX 2GX 2GX 3GX 3GX 4GX 4整體命名空間EngEngProj_ABCProj_ABC Proj_XYZProj_XYZHWHWSWSWDocsDocs SimSim SynSynFibreFibreChannelChannel存儲的靈活卷GigE 顧客網(wǎng)絡(luò)對位于對位于SWSW目錄上目錄上文件的文件的NFSNFS請求請求LinuxLinuxComputeComputeGridGridGXGXClusterClusterGigE 群集網(wǎng)絡(luò)顧客可以mount到任何服務(wù)器上,存取整個命名空間舉例:從位于GX1的服務(wù)器端口,存取位于GX3上的靈活卷SW提供高性能選擇好處 創(chuàng)建跨
15、多個控制器節(jié)點(diǎn)的靈活卷 將靈活卷的通量擴(kuò)展到多GB/秒 將靈活卷的大小擴(kuò)展到數(shù)百TB 傳送多GB/秒的通量給重要文件和目錄 保持管理的簡單性 用相同的存儲系統(tǒng)于多個應(yīng)用需求ProjectsProjectsX XB BC CA1A1A2A2A3A3 B1B1B2B2 C1C1C2C2C3C3B BC CA1A1A2A2A3A3B1B1B2B2C1C1C2C2C3C3LinuxLinux計算網(wǎng)格GX ClusterGX Cluster整體命名空間FV3FV3 FV4FV4FV7FV7 FV8FV8FV11FV11FV12FV12FV1FV1 FV2FV2FV5FV5 FV6FV6FV9FV9 FV
16、10FV10條帶化的卷X透明擴(kuò)展 透明數(shù)據(jù)移動 用于存儲擴(kuò)展好處 迅速無縫地啟用新存儲和/或應(yīng)用 無需宕機(jī)時間 對計算節(jié)點(diǎn)透明,不改變命名空間ABCA1A2A3B1B2C1C2C3ProjectsABCA1 A2 A3 B1 B2C1 C2 C3把數(shù)據(jù)移到新添加的存儲上把數(shù)據(jù)移到新添加的存儲上BB整體命名空間ProjProjA AB BC CD DA1A1 A2A2B1B1 B2B2 B3B3 C1C1 C2C2 C3C3D1D1 D2D2 D3D3C1C1B1B1GX 1GX 1GX 2GX 2GX 3GX 3GX 4GX 4FibreFibreChannelChannel存儲的靈活卷GXG
17、XClusterClusterA1A1ProjProjA2A2D1D1B2B2D2D2C2C2B3B3D3D3C3C3A3 A3 A3A3A3A3 鏡像的靈活卷GigE群集網(wǎng)絡(luò)與整體命名空間透明結(jié)合不需要修改顧客 直接mount到有鏡像數(shù)據(jù)的節(jié)點(diǎn), 可以從本地鏡像讀取數(shù)據(jù)需要遠(yuǎn)程數(shù)據(jù)的DFS請求, 將被輪流分布到可用的鏡像上 舉例:靈活卷A3讀取頻率很高GX3正在變飽和鏡像創(chuàng)建在GX2,3,4Mount到GX2,3,4的顧客可以直接讀取Mount到GX1的顧客將通過DFS從其它三個節(jié)點(diǎn)讀取A3數(shù)據(jù) 透明數(shù)據(jù)移動 適宜優(yōu)化負(fù)載好處 優(yōu)化性能 充分利用磁盤空間 不影響應(yīng)用運(yùn)行 對顧客透明, 不改變
18、命名空間舉例: 優(yōu)化項目A的響應(yīng)時間ABCA1A2A3B1B2C1C2C3ProjectsABCA1 A2 A3 B1 B2C1 C2 C3項目項目A 得到專用資源得到專用資源應(yīng)用情況: 分層存儲 根據(jù)磁盤的價格/性能比匹配磁盤 在同一命名空間內(nèi)管理主存儲與二級存儲 分層存儲應(yīng)用: 歸檔 盤到盤備份 引用數(shù)據(jù)應(yīng)用情況: 順序I/O應(yīng)用 用ATA的價格,取得FC的性能 對不同的磁盤或應(yīng)用要求,提供不同的RAID保護(hù)(如提供2塊磁盤失效的數(shù)據(jù)保護(hù))BCA2A3C1C2AProjectsABCA1 A2 A3 B1 B2C1 C2 C3A1B1主存儲(所有工作負(fù)載得到最高性能所有工作負(fù)載得到最高性能
19、)二級存儲(較低的 $/GB)B2C3靈活卷移動時命名空間保持靈活卷移動時命名空間保持傳統(tǒng)卷,F(xiàn)lexVolv卷是存儲的基本建設(shè)模塊卷是存儲的基本建設(shè)模塊v數(shù)據(jù)管理的操作和計劃均圍繞卷進(jìn)行數(shù)據(jù)管理的操作和計劃均圍繞卷進(jìn)行 快照 備份和恢復(fù) 空間的分配和供應(yīng)v問題在于問題在于: : 卷與底層的磁盤是密不可分的卷與底層的磁盤是密不可分的 缺乏靈活性缺乏靈活性 難于按應(yīng)用特性分卷難于按應(yīng)用特性分卷 空間利用率低空間利用率低 性能難于優(yōu)化性能難于優(yōu)化4 數(shù)據(jù)存儲和管理的主要單位數(shù)據(jù)存儲和管理的主要單位仍舊是仍舊是WAFL 卷卷4 FlexVol: 不再直接與物理存儲不再直接與物理存儲掛鉤掛鉤4 FlexVol: 每個每個aggregate可有多可有多個個4 存儲空間能夠很容易被再分配存儲空間能夠很容易被再分配AggregateDisksDisksDisksFlexVols4 Aggregate包含物理存儲包含物理存儲RG1RG2RG3AggregateRG1RG2RG3FlexVol1
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負(fù)責(zé)。
- 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 金屬冶煉(黑色)企業(yè)主要負(fù)責(zé)人試卷(樣卷1)
- 2024年環(huán)境噪聲監(jiān)測儀項目合作計劃書
- 信息化改造項目合同
- 機(jī)械買賣合同協(xié)議書(33篇)
- 平安創(chuàng)建自查報告
- 2023年三明市沙縣區(qū)總醫(yī)院筆試真題
- 2023年桂林市田家炳中學(xué)招聘教師筆試真題
- 2024全新版房地產(chǎn)交易標(biāo)準(zhǔn)合同匯編
- 2024年奧沙利鉑合作協(xié)議書
- 餐館合同范本
- 校園普及心肺復(fù)蘇課件
- 汽車系職業(yè)生涯規(guī)劃總結(jié)報告
- 《學(xué)習(xí)的概述》課件
- 人教版六年級數(shù)學(xué)上冊期末復(fù)習(xí)系列之口算題專項練習(xí)(原卷版)(全國通用)
- 《手表基礎(chǔ)知識》課件
- GB/T 28054-2023鋼質(zhì)無縫氣瓶集束裝置
- 小學(xué)《道德與法治》課程學(xué)習(xí)評價
- 2023年度武漢房地產(chǎn)市場報告2024.1.12
- 2024線上沖鋒衣市場趨勢報告
- 新人教版九年級下數(shù)學(xué)27-1《圖形的相似》課件
- 腹腔鏡手術(shù)后患者的護(hù)理查房
評論
0/150
提交評論